NASA is inviting innovators and organizations to take Earth observation to the next level. Through the A.10 INNOVATE program, the agency aims to transform satellite data and Earth system models into actionable insights that benefit society, drive economic growth, and support national security. This initiative seeks bold, high-impact projects that bridge the gap between concept and real-world implementation, offering researchers and commercial partners access to NASA’s expertise and resources.
At its core, A.10 INNOVATE encourages projects that are high-risk yet potentially revolutionary—endeavors too speculative for traditional funding sources. The program emphasizes the integration of NASA’s Earth observation data, along with data from its partners, into decision-support systems that can inform policy, business, and scientific applications. By fostering collaboration between government, commercial entities, and non-governmental organizations, the program also aims to stimulate the emerging space economy and strengthen the ecosystem of Earth information providers.
The recent ROSES-2025 Amendment 41 introduces key updates to A.10 INNOVATE. Notably, Sections 1 and 1.1 now encourage non-governmental organizations that are new to NASA to collaborate with NASA centers. Additionally, Section 4 requires proposals to include a plan for operations beyond the award period, ensuring projects have sustainability and long-term impact. Proposals can be submitted at any time until August 31, 2026, providing a flexible window for innovators to participate. The official amendment will be posted on NASA’s research opportunity homepage around January 26, 2026 at NASA ROSES-2025
